2017-10-30 4 views
1

私は私のラムダ計算のための特定のデータを引き出すためのAthenaへのSQLクエリを呼び出すpythonラムダを持っています。どのようにラムダでAthenaクエリの単体テストを行うのですか?ラムダは他のいくつかのサービスを使用しているので、私はMOTOを使ってサービスを模擬しました。どのようにPythonのラムダでテストawsのアテナSQLクエリをユニットですか?

答えて

1

ビジネスロジックが偶数とコンテキストのようなラムダ固有のコードから分離されている限り、ユニットテストコードをローカルに書くことができると思います。 Hereがその例です。

残念ながら、モトはまだアテナをサポートしていません。ユースケースを使用して新しい機能をリクエストするか、新しいプルリクエストを行うことができます。とにかくコミュニティがあなたを助けます。 GitHub - moto

関連する問題